Football Selected 17th in AFCA Preseason Coaches' Poll


WORCESTER, Mass. - Assumption College Football is ranked 17th in the American Football Coaches Association Preseason Coaches' Poll, as announced by the AFCA on Tuesday.

The Hounds earned 292 total points for the program's highest AFCA preseason ranking in school history. Reigning DII Champions Texas A&M-Commerce took the top spot with 748 points and 13 first place votes while DII runner-up West Florida was second with 721 points, including 14 first place votes. Overall, three other Super Region One teams earned national rankings, in Indiana (Pa.) (No. 4), Shepherd (No. 16) and Findlay (No. 25).

Assumption is coming off the most successful season in program history, going 11-2 overall and reaching the NCAA Division II Quarterfinals in 2017. The Hounds fell by just five points to Indiana (Pa.) in the contest and concluded the year ranked ninth in the AFCA National Poll. As a team, the Hounds were dominant throughout the year, averaging a school-record 43.4 points per game while allowing just 15.5 points per game. They finished the year as the nation's leaders in interceptions (26), punt return average (23.3), turnovers gained (39) and turnover margin (1.77), as well as special teams touchdowns (9). The team also returns 11 NE10 All-Conference performers, including a pair of All-Region selections in 2018.

The Hounds open their 2018 campaign when they host Kutztown on Sept. 1 at 1 p.m. in Multi-Sport Stadium.
